In national parks, the species is … WebThe Committee on the Status of Endangered Wildlife in Canada (COSEWIC) was created in 1977 as a result of a recommendation at the Federal-Provincial Wildlife Conference held in 1976. It arose from the need for a single, official, scientifically sound, national listing of wildlife species at risk.

WebSpecies that were designated at risk by COSEWIC (Committee on the Status of Endangered Wildlife in Canada) prior to October 1999 must be reassessed using revised criteria before they can be considered for addition to Schedule 1 of SARA. Species that are on Schedule 2 or 3 are not automatically included on the List of Wildlife Species at Risk.
